6 months agoExcellent place for kids. My kids loved it, the rides are awesome and mostly have 1$ ticket. Train ride is too good for kids and parents. Walking tracks in the park are beautiful.

9 months agoGreat morning at the park. Took my toddler. He was a bit too young for the individual rides, but had fun on the carousel, train, and playground. Kides need to be over 30in for the individual kids' rides. My parents took me here when I was little. It's so nice to be able to share it with my son. No line for tickets, and everything is reasonably priced.
